LWSC plans to renovate water treatment plant

Summary by Itemlive
Olivia HaydarLYNN — The Water and Sewer Commission plans to renovate the existing water and sewage treatment plants rather than invest in new facilities, following commissioners’ recent walk-throughs of both buildings. …
